COCHRAN'S 1930 REVUE
Composer: Vivian
Ellis
Lyricist: Beverly Nichols
Opened: March 27, 1930, London Pavilion Theatre, London
Performances: Unknown
Note: An unknown selection appears on 78/Parlophone R617 (Leslie Hutchinson, piano and voice).
